1/22. synovitis of small joints: sonographic guided diagnostic and therapeutic approach.

    OBJECTIVE: The aim of this pictorial essay is to describe the sonographic guided approach to investigation and local injection therapy of a small joint in a patient with psoriatic arthritis (PA). methods: Sonographic pictures are obtained using a high frequency ultrasonography apparatus equipped with a 13-MHz transducer. RESULTS: ultrasonography allows a careful morphostructural assessment of soft tissue involvement in PA patients. Sonographic findings include joint cavity widening, capsular thickening, synovial proliferation, synovial fluid changes, tendon sheath widening. Ultrasound guided placement of the needle within the joint and injection of corticosteroid under sonographic control can be easily performed. CONCLUSIONS: High frequency ultrasonography is a quick and safe procedure that allows a useful diagnostic and therapeutic approach in patients with arthritis of small joints.

2/22. diagnostic imaging of pigmented villonodular synovitis of the temporomandibular joint associated with condylar expansion.

    Pigmented villonodular synovitis (PVNS) is a rare lesion of the temporomandibular joint. We report a case which was initially misdiagnosed as a parotid tumor. CT revealed a well-defined mass demonstrating higher attenuation than the adjacent soft tissue with marked expansion of the mandibular condyle. MRI clearly delineated the extent of the lesion which had very low signal intensity on both T1W and T2W sequences due to the effect of hemosiderin. The usefulness of these imaging procedures in diagnosis of PVNS is discussed.

3/22. Sea urchin puncture resulting in PIP joint synovial arthritis: case report and MRI study.

    Of the 600 species of sea urchins, approximately 80 may be venomous to humans. The long spined or black sea urchin, Diadema setosum may cause damage by the breaking off of its brittle spines after they penetrate the skin. synovitis followed by arthritis may be an unusual but apparently not a rare sequel to such injury, when implantation occurs near a joint. In this case report, osseous changes were not seen by plain x-rays. magnetic resonance imaging (MRI) was used to expose the more salient features of both soft tissue and bone changes of black sea urchin puncture injury 30 months after penetration. In all likelihood, this type of injury may be more common than the existing literature at present suggests. It is believed to be the first reported case in this part of the world as well as the first MRI study describing this type of joint pathology. Local and systemic reactions to puncture injuries from sea urchin spines have been described previously. These may range from mild, local irritation lasting a few days to granuloma formation, infection and on occasions systemic illness. The sea urchin spines are composed of calcium carbonate with proteinaceous covering. The covering tends to cause immune reactions of variable presentation. There are only a handful of reported cases with sea urchin stings on record, none of them from the Red Sea. However, this condition is probably more common than is thought and can present difficulty in diagnosis. In this case report, the inflammation responded well to heat treatment, mobilization and manipulation of the joint in its post acute and chronic stages. As some subtle changes in soft tissues and the changes in bone were not seen either on plain x-rays or ultrasound scan, gadolinium-enhanced MRI was used to unveil the marked changes in the joint.

4/22. Snapping knee caused by intra-articular tumors.

    Locking of the knee can present with no history of antecedent injury. We identified impingement of intra-articular tumors in 2 cases. Intra-articular tumors are relatively rare. Mechanical symptoms were present in both cases. On physical examination, there was a palpable mass at the medial region of the patellofemoral joint. The interior had been replaced mainly by amorphous necrotic tissue. The definite diagnosis of a soft-tissue mass of the knee could not be made on histologic examination.

5/22. Posterior approach for arthroscopic treatment of posterolateral impingement syndrome of the ankle in a top-level field hockey player.

    A case history of a 25-year-old field hockey player, a member of the German National Field hockey Team, is presented. The patient could not remember any specific ankle injury, but since the World Indoor Championship in February 2003, he experienced significant but diffuse pain around the posterior ankle, especially while loading the forefoot in hockey training and competition. For 2 months, the patient was unable to run. Conservative treatment failed, and surgery was performed. Posterior ankle arthroscopy revealed a frayed posterior intermalleolar ligament and meniscoid-like scar tissue at the posterolateral ankle, indicating a posterolateral soft tissue ankle impingement syndrome. A concomitant inflammation of the posterolateral ankle and subtalar synovium was present. After arthroscopic resection and early functional aftertreatment, the patient returned to full high-level sports ability within 2 months.

6/22. Mycobacterial synovitis caused by slow-growing nonchromogenic species: eighteen cases and a review of the literature.

    CONTEXT: Slow-growing nonchromogenic mycobacterial species are an infrequent cause of soft tissue infection. Because these organisms are rare, they are not often initially considered in the differential diagnosis of synovitis. OBJECTIVE: To evaluate the clinical and pathologic characteristics of patients with synovitis resulting from slow-growing nonchromogenic mycobacterial species. DESIGN: A 20-year retrospective review of records from The Methodist Hospital microbiology Laboratory identified 18 culture-positive cases of synovitis that resulted from slow-growing nonchromogenic mycobacteria, including 14 caused by mycobacterium avium complex, 1 caused by Mycobacterium malmoense, 1 caused by mycobacterium haemophilum, and 2 caused by Mycobacterium nonchromogenicum isolates. In addition, a comprehensive literature search revealed an additional 48 cases of synovitis caused by slow-growing nonchromogenic mycobacteria. RESULTS: The historic literature described the majority of the 48 patients as previously healthy, elderly individuals with a several-month history of monoarticular pain and swelling in the small joints of the upper extremity. In contrast, the current series demonstrated the probable role of multiple chronic coexisting medical conditions in promoting disease susceptibility. These patients were also unique in their significantly younger age distribution and diversity of infection sites. Histologic examination and direct acid-fast bacteria stains generally did not aid the diagnosis. amputation was performed in 2 patients because of delayed identification of disease. CONCLUSIONS: The current series demonstrates that difficult identification and infrequent occurrence cause these organisms to be overlooked by physicians and laboratory personnel. A heightened clinical suspicion for slow-growing nonchromogenic mycobacterial species is necessary when routine culture and histopathologic findings do not readily isolate an organism, or when the patient does not respond to antibiotic and anti-inflammatory treatment.

7/22. Staphylococcal septic synovitis of the sternoclavicular joint with retrosternal extension.

    Bacterial arthritis of the sternoclavicular joint is an uncommon disorder caused by a variety of microorganisms. Both Gram-positive and gram-negative bacteria have been identified as etiologies of an acute suppurative arthritis, whereas a few other bacteria such as mycobacteria and treponemes have been incriminated in chronic disease of the sternoclavicular joint. We recently treated a patient with staphylococcal synovitis of the sternoclavicular joint, which is the 24th recorded in the literature. His illness was complicated by a retrosternal abscess, soft tissue abscess of the chest, septic bursitis, and lumbosacral discitis. He recovered after 6 weeks of nafcillin therapy without any residual infection. Six previous patients with extension into the substernal space and mediastinum have been described. Staphylococcal infection of the sternoclavicular joint, although usually confined to the joint, can be associated with sepsis and metastatic abscess formation as well as substernal extension even in immunocompetent individuals.

8/22. Case report 590: Diffuse pigmented villonodular synovitis with a cartilaginous component.

    The authors present the case of a patient 54 years of age who developed well-defined osteolysis in the distal end of the humerus, with a slight radiodensity in the soft tissue. The radionuclide scintigram and above all the CT, were useful in defining the characteristics and expansion of the mass more precisely. Surgical intervention and histological examination demonstrated a seemingly unique case of PVNS of the elbow with diffuse cartilaginous components and erosion of the distal end of the humerus. The pathological findings in this unusual case, actually suggested the possibility of an intermediate form of PVNS associated with synovial chondromatosis.

9/22. synovitis in angioimmunoblastic lymphadenopathy with dysproteinemia simulating rheumatoid arthritis.

    We describe a patient with angioimmunoblastic lymphadenopathy with dysproteinemia who developed a symmetric, rheumatoid-like, peripheral polyarthritis. Radiographs of the involved joints revealed soft tissue swelling without erosions or cartilage loss. rheumatoid factor and fluorescent antinuclear antibodies were negative, and c-reactive protein and erythrocyte sedimentation rate were normal. synovial fluid analysis showed an inflammatory effusion (white blood cell count of 3,500/mm3, with 76% polymorphonuclear leukocytes). A closed synovial biopsy of the wrist revealed a mononuclear infiltrate consistent with angioimmunoblastic lymphadenopathy with dysproteinemia. Monthly parenteral chemotherapy treatment with high-dose methyl-prednisolone and cyclophosphamide resulted in remission of all manifestations of disease, including arthritis.

10/22. Pigmented villonodular synovitis of the talus in a child.

    An unusual case of localized pigmented villonodular synovitis of the ankle joint in a 3-year-old boy is described. The child was brought to the hospital because of abrupt onset of pain and joint effusion. A soft tissue mass eroding the talar dome was seen in roentgenograms. Exact diagnosis was established by excisional biopsy. curettage of the lesion resulted in healing without recurrence at 10-year follow-up examination.
